Dell NetWorker 19.9 Administration Guide

How to identify WORM media

Since WORM media cannot be reused, the tapes are uniquely identified as such so that they are only used when required. As shown in this figure, a (W) is appended to the volume names displayed in the Volumes window. If a volume is both read-only and WORM, an (R) is appended to the volume name.

Figure 1. Identifying WORM tapes in the NetWorker Console
Identifying WORM tapes
NOTE:Since WORM tapes can only be used once, attempting to relabel a WORM tape always results in a write protection error. With the exception of pool selection and relabeling, the NetWorker software treats WORM tapes exactly the same as all other types of tape.
